Subject: DR drill — tracing across Murrelet services. Plugin authors: during Saturday's failover drill, trace headers from the Copperline gateway will be replayed into the standby cluster, so your spans may appear duplicated. Please keep trace IDs propagated unmodified and log sampling decisions verbosely so we can audit gaps. Do not rotate credentials mid-drill. To reattach your plugin to the standby trace collector, enter the recovery passphrase shown below.

unlock words, bahop-fawef: novmir-druwyn-soriel-rusdor-kasion

MEETING NOTES (excerpt) — Master Keys, Pellerton Depot

Quick recap for the dispatch desk: the full set of Pellerton master keys is back from Drayhorse Locksmiths after re-cutting. All nine keys checked against the register — fine. They go out tomorrow to the Westhollow site in the grey lockbox, via Marlin Express. Usual drill: rider signs the chit, desk keeps the stub. One extra step this time — tell the Marlin rider this at hand-over:

dispatch memo: the quenax olidor courier leaves the lamvan aldath keliel ledger at gate 2085 under passcode 005795

Welcome aboard! Quick note on template rendering in Snailforge: the Plover engine caches compiled templates aggressively, so most slowness comes from cold starts, not the templates themselves. Don't micro-optimize loops before profiling with the built-in tracer. Ask Jora if numbers look weird. To unlock the shared profiling workspace on your first run, use the recovery passphrase below.

strongbox words: istwyn-normir-silwyn-ulaius-istwyn

The internal API gateway (Hollowbridge) began returning 429s to the signature verification sidecar after last week's rate-limit tightening. When verification requests are throttled, the sidecar treats the timeout as a failed signature and rejects valid artifacts. Workaround: the verifier pool is now exempted from the per-tenant bucket via the bypass header. Future maintainers should keep the exemption until the verifier batches its calls. For reference during re-verification, the artifact signing key in use is below.

rollout seal: bky9_PeXH1fTLY